Culture, vie sociale, jeunesse et sports

In 2025, Clamart spent 20.5 M€ on this. That is €372 per inhabitant.

Against towns of the same size

More than elsewhere. Clamart devotes 28.4% of its operating budget to this. Towns of 50,000 to 100,000 inhabitants usually devote 21.2%.

In euros per inhabitant: €372, against €300 usually (+24 %).

2025 operating expenditure, as the town voted it by function. Source: DGFiP — balances comptables, présentation croisée nature-fonction. The comparison is first on the share of the operating budget — the reading that does not depend on how wealthy the town is — then on euros per inhabitant, against the median of towns in the same DGFiP population band. Transfers to the inter-municipal body are excluded on both sides.
